Simulation games are celebrated for their ability to mimic real-world systems with astonishing detail, allowing players to manage and manipulate environments in a manner that feels both educational and entertaining. Titles like 'The Sims' and 'SimCity' have dominated this category for decades, offering players the chance to create and control worlds from the ground up. Whether it's designing the intricate layout of a bustling metropolis or orchestrating the daily life of virtual characters, these games challenge players to think critically and make strategic decisions.

In recent years, the genre has evolved to encompass a wide array of themes and complexities. For instance, 'Stardew Valley' invites players to cultivate their own farms, blending elements of agriculture with community-building and adventure. On the other hand, 'Kerbal Space Program' pushes the boundaries by allowing players to design and launch spacecraft in an attempt to explore the cosmos, challenging their understanding of physics and engineering.
